#d030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d030ba is composed of 81.6% red, 18.8%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.9% magenta, 10.6%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 308.3 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 50.2%. #d030ba color hex could be obtained by blending #ff60ff with #a10075.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#d030ba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d030ba has RGB values of R:208, G:48,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.11,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13643962.

Hex triplet d030ba #d030ba
RGB Decimal 208, 48, 186 rgb(208,48,186)
RGB Percent 81.6, 18.8, 72.9 rgb(81.6%,18.8%,72.9%)
CMYK 0, 77, 11, 18
HSL 308.3°, 63, 50.2 hsl(308.3,63%,50.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 308.3°, 76.9, 81.6
Web Safe cc33cc #cc33cc
CIE-LAB 50.771, 73.73, -37.346
XYZ 35.932, 19.072, 48.24
xyY 0.348, 0.185, 19.072
CIE-LCH 50.771, 82.649, 333.136
CIE-LUV 50.771, 72.674, -66.381
Hunter-Lab 43.671, 70.443, -34.924
Binary 11010000, 00110000, 10111010

Shades and Tints of #d030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fcf0f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d030ba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827e81 is the less saturated color, while #f709d6 is the most saturated one.
